v2ray + nginx 网站部署完全指南

目录

1. 简介

v2ray 是一款功能强大的代理软件,可以用于科学上网、翻墙等场景。nginx 是一款高性能的 Web 服务器,可以用于部署网站。本文将介绍如何使用 v2ray 和 nginx 配合部署网站,实现安全可靠的网站访问。

2. 软件安装

2.1 安装 v2ray

  1. 访问 v2ray 官网下载最新版本的安装包。
  2. 解压安装包并运行安装脚本。
  3. 根据提示完成 v2ray 的安装和配置。

2.2 安装 nginx

  1. 访问 nginx 官网下载最新版本的安装包。
  2. 解压安装包并运行安装脚本。
  3. 根据提示完成 nginx 的安装和配置。

3. 配置步骤

3.1 v2ray 配置

  1. 编辑 v2ray 的配置文件,设置服务器地址、端口、协议等参数。
  2. 启动 v2ray 服务并验证是否正常运行。

3.2 nginx 配置

  1. 编辑 nginx 的配置文件,设置网站根目录、域名、SSL 证书等参数。
  2. 将 v2ray 的 WebSocket 配置添加到 nginx 配置中。
  3. 重启 nginx 服务并验证网站是否可以正常访问。

4. 验证和测试

  1. 使用浏览器访问网站,检查是否可以正常访问。
  2. 使用 v2ray 客户端连接代理服务器,检查是否可以正常访问网站。
  3. 对网站进行压力测试,确保性能和稳定性。

5. 常见问题解答

5.1 如何更新 v2ray 和 nginx?

  1. 访问 v2ray 和 nginx 官网下载最新版本的安装包。
  2. 停止服务并备份配置文件。
  3. 解压安装包并运行安装脚本。
  4. 恢复配置文件并重启服务。

5.2 为什么无法访问网站?

  1. 检查 v2ray 和 nginx 服务是否正常运行。
  2. 检查防火墙和安全组是否正确配置。
  3. 检查域名和 SSL 证书是否正确配置。

5.3 如何排查问题?

  1. 查看 v2ray 和 nginx 的日志文件,寻找错误信息。
  2. 使用 pingtelnet 等命令检查网络连通性。
  3. 使用 curl 命令检查 HTTP 请求和响应。
  4. 如果无法解决,可以寻求专业技术支持。
正文完